Output 8c7a2ccf5a1f6f159f885ca25ecdedddf986d0361f7e8f46b2a18319fee17afc:0

value
3886873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e8975db4b716c3e87ca34ad96cd91c81e4df321 OP_EQUAL
address
3DE5jdRhb2JfauU4FMQ9hYHXc3wi3yG16C
transaction
8c7a2ccf5a1f6f159f885ca25ecdedddf986d0361f7e8f46b2a18319fee17afc
spent
true